例如,我需要向所有spring集成组件添加自定义属性-需要向所有入站和出站网关添加'description'属性。
一旦我们能够添加自定义属性,我就需要记录新添加的属性-'description'。
能否请您提出建议的方法。
谢谢
答案 0 :(得分:0)
我已经向您解释了如何实现,因为Java本质。现在,让我们想象一下我们可以在此问题上做些什么。您可以在应用程序上下文中注册一些其他支持Bean,并使它们与集成组件保持联系。例如,通过一些id
模式或诸如简单的HashMap
之类的键值存储。因此,通过这种方式,只要您能够访问原始组件,或者总是依靠其id
或调用地图注册表,您将始终能够提取该附加信息。